Wonda Grobbelaar is a forward-thinking researcher at the intersection of robotics, vocational training, and the future of work, with a particular focus on the hospitality and food service industries. Her work examines how industrial robots and artificial intelligence are reshaping the food chain—from farm to fork—and redefining customer expectations in an increasingly complex sector. Her most cited paper, “Analyzing Human Robotic Interaction in the Food Industry” (2021, 51 citations), provides a foundational look at how automation is being integrated to boost production and quality. Grobbelaar also explores the ripple effects of these technologies on employment and education, as seen in her studies on vocational training for Industry 4.0 in smart cities (2020) and future employments in hospitality (2024). Her research on smart innovation in tourism and hospitality (2023) further highlights how data sciences and ICT are driving systemic change. With a keen eye on the post-pandemic landscape—where robots sanitize restaurants and AI becomes ubiquitous—Grobbelaar’s work offers critical insights for students and professionals navigating the automation of service industries.
